This post was last edited by ylb913 on 2015-10-13 at 10:33. In fact, HG/T 20546.5-2009 explains things quite clearly. The double-column connecting beam may not have longitudinal beams; if necessary, a \"longitudinal connecting beam\" will be added at \"half the height of the floor.\" The crossbeams for each floor are connected to the columns on the left and right, and the number of such crossbeams is equal to the number of columns (two beams per pair, with one pair counted as one unit). Between the longitudinal truss frames, there must be \"longitudinal beams\"; some of the crossbeams are fixed or supported by the left and right longitudinal beams. The spacing between the crossbeams is independent of the spacing between the columns, and in most cases, the number of crossbeams is greater than the number of paired columns.

A longitudinal tie beam has longitudinal members only when pipes extend from its sides; otherwise, it has none. Moreover, the position of its longitudinal members is at half the height above and below the cross beams. A longitudinal tube support structure must have longitudinal beams, and these beams are used to support the cross beams; they are generally located at the height of the floor level, with the cross beams being placed on top of these longitudinal beams.
